What makes hotels money?

A hotel's primary revenue stream is typically room revenue. This is the money earned from renting out rooms to guests. Other primary revenue streams may include food and beverage sales, meeting and event space rental, and parking fees.

While there isn't a lot of data about average hotel profit margins available publicly, here are some relevant statistics. In the first 10 months of 2022, the average gross operating profit for U.S. hotels was 38%, compared to 39% in 2019. Profit margins can vary broadly by department.

The Biggest Expense in a Hotel If you've guessed labor costs, you were right. On average, labor costs generate 40% of a hotel's total operating costs.

The income you receive from a hotel room investment is passive. The management company do all the things that a landlord would normally do. They market the property, take bookings, collect 'rent', conduct exit checks, and keep the room clean and well maintained.
